Lysine caused a greater depression in growth of chicks fed a diet con taining casein than a diet containing a combination of safflower meal, corn gluten meal and soybean meal. Clycine, in the presence of arginine, appeared to exhibit a synergistic effect in alleviating the growth depression induced by an excess of lysine. Highly selective binding of basic amino acids, i.e. lysine, arginine, and histidine, by a negatively charged carboxylatopillar[5]arene (CP5A) is reported. And the complexation behavior of the CP5A host towards lysine metabolites including cadaverine (Cad), acetyl-l-lysine (AcLys) and trimethyl-l-lysine (TMLys) is also described.

Pseudomonas aeruginosa PACI grows poorly on L-lysine as sole source of carbon but mutant derivatives which grow rapidly were readily isolated. Studies with one such mutant, P. aeruginosa PAC586, supported the existence of a route for L-lysine catabolism which differes from those reported previously in other species of Pseudomonas. In planning the present experiment it was assumed that, if the diet of a lactating ruminant is devoid of lysine and the animal is in positive nitrogen balance, the lysine in the milk must have been synthesized in the animal by the micro-organisms in its paunch. The transcription of genes located in subtelomeric regions of yeast chromosomes is repressed relative to the rest of the genome. This repression requires wild-type nucleosome levels but not the telomere silencing factors Sir2, Sir3, Sir4, and Rap1. Hydroxylysine was first isolated from gelatin (2) and probably does not occur in proteins of mammalian origin other than collagen (3).
